Plan for the Novel Coronavirus 2019-nCoV, but Don’t Forget about the Seasonal Flu.
Although the cases have slowed in some areas, we still expect a heavy flu season. According to the CDC’s January 18 FLUVIEW, we’re up to 15-million U.S. flu illnesses, 140,000 hospitalizations, and 8,200 deaths, especially among the young. From the...
